A Handbook for Patients with CRPS or RSD ― Learn the about the Neuroscience of Pain and Graded Motor Imagery to Help Desensitize the Tissues

The suffering of Complex Regional Pain Syndrome (CRPS), formerly Reflex Sympathetic Dystrophy (RSD), is very real. However, all pain is produced by your nervous system and brain, and knowing this is the key to your recovery. Since movement creates pain, you must first desensitize your tissues through knowledge, understanding, stress reduction and simple graded motor imagery techniques.

Simply put, the more you know about pain, the better off you'll be. This patient book, written in easily digestible language, explains how pain works and details a series of mental exercises, techniques and strategies that will prepare you for physical movement of painful body parts.

Written by clinical neuroscience experts with dozens of years of combined experience researching and working with pain patients, this book is written in an easy-to-read format with illustrations for better understanding.

In Why Are My Nerves So Sensitive you’ll learn about:

  • Sensitivity, Complex Regional Pain Syndrome (CRPS) and Reflex Sympathetic Dystrophy (RSD)
  • The role of the nervous system and the brain in the experience of pain
  • How nerves work like an “alarm system” to alert your brain that there is a problem
  • How pain in one area of the body affects other parts of the body
  • How to turn your alarm system (nervous system) down to treat pain
  • What your brain’s body maps are and how they work
  • How to restore body maps
  • Simple, effective treatment strategies that can help you start feeling better fast

 

Studies show that the more you know about pain and how it works, the better off you’ll be. Written in an easy-to-read format with illustrations for better understanding, this guide can help those seeking RSD or CRPS pain relief.

Written by physical therapist and neuroscience researcher Adriaan Louw, PT, PhD, along with co-authors Colleen Louw, PT, MEd, CSMT, TPS, PSF, and Kory Zimney, PT, DPT, CSMT.

Illustrated. Spiral-bound softcover; 82 pages.

ABOUT THE AUTHOR:

Adriaan has taught throughout the US and internationally for 20 years at numerous national and international manual therapy, pain science and medical conferences. He is a Certified Spinal Manual Therapist, Therapeutic Pain Specialist and has authored and co-authored over 50 peer-reviewed articles, books and book chapters related to spinal disorders and pain science. He is the Director of the Therapeutic Neuroscience Research Group – an independent collaborative initiative studying pain neuroscience and is the Program Director of the Therapeutic Pain Specialist and Pain Science Fellowship post-graduate program for Evidence in Motion.
